Apple products have become an essential part of how students learn at Flitch Green Academy, a public elementary/middle school located just outside of London. Flitch Green’s unique approach is taught through open-ended “experiences” where students use iPad, Mac, and iPod touch, alongside more traditional media, to work on cross-curricular learning projects. “This allows children to use all the resources they have available to them to represent what we’ve asked them to do,” says principal Helen Johnson. “And normally they come back with things that we won’t have even dreamt of.”
